Yitzhak Rabin

The quote “We accept every form or way to talk to the Syrians how to achieve peace” emphasizes the importance of open dialogue and inclusivity in discussions aimed at resolving conflict. It suggests a willingness to engage with diverse perspectives, methods, and means of communication when working towards peace, particularly in a complex and multifaceted situation like that in Syria.

At its core, this statement advocates for an approach that recognizes the value of various voices—be they local communities, activists, government representatives, or international bodies—in shaping a path toward reconciliation. In conflict situations, different groups often have unique insights into their experiences and needs; thus, accepting every form of communication can help identify common ground and foster mutual understanding.

From multiple perspectives:

1. **Cultural Sensitivity**: Accepting various ways to communicate respects cultural differences. Peace talks might not only occur through formal discussions but could also happen via art, storytelling, or community gatherings—methods deeply rooted in local traditions.

2. **Empowerment**: By engaging with all parties involved—including marginalized voices—the process empowers those who may otherwise feel voiceless in traditional negotiations. This can lead to more sustainable outcomes since stakeholders are more likely to commit if they see their concerns reflected.

3. **Innovation**: Embracing diverse methods encourages creative solutions that go beyond conventional diplomacy. For instance, digital platforms can be used for dialogue where face-to-face meetings are impossible due to safety concerns.
